    Chapter 1: Introduction

    ●  Overview of the challenges posed by climate change to agriculture

    Climate change presents significant challenges to agriculture, impacting various aspects of crop production, livestock management, and overall food security. These challenges arise from the changing patterns of temperature, precipitation, and extreme weather events. Here's an overview of the key challenges posed by climate change to agriculture:

    Temperature Extremes:

    Rising temperatures can negatively affect crop growth and development. Excessive heat can lead to reduced yields, affect flowering and pollination, and increase the likelihood of heat stress in livestock. Certain crops have specific temperature requirements for optimal growth, and shifts in temperature patterns can disrupt these requirements.

    Changing Precipitation Patterns:

    Altered rainfall patterns, including increased frequency of droughts and heavy rainfall events, can disrupt planting schedules, reduce water availability for irrigation, and lead to soil erosion. Droughts can cause water stress for crops and livestock, while heavy rainfall can lead to flooding, soil degradation, and nutrient leaching.

    Water Scarcity:

    Climate change can exacerbate water scarcity in many regions, as changing precipitation patterns and increased evaporation rates reduce water availability for agriculture. This can lead to conflicts over water resources and limit irrigation options, impacting crop production.

    Pests and Diseases:

    Warmer temperatures can lead to the expansion of pests and diseases that were once confined to specific regions. Insects, fungi, and pathogens that thrive in warmer climates can spread to new areas, affecting crops and livestock that have not evolved to defend against them.

    Crop Yield Variability:

    Erratic weather patterns caused by climate change can lead to increased variability in crop yields from year to year. Farmers may struggle to predict and manage these fluctuations, affecting their income and food security.

    Shifts in Growing Seasons:

    Changing climate conditions can disrupt traditional growing seasons. Warmer temperatures can cause crops to mature earlier or later than usual, affecting overall harvest timing and potentially reducing yields.

    Soil Degradation:

    Extreme weather events like heavy rainfall and flooding can lead to soil erosion and nutrient loss. Increased temperatures and changing rainfall patterns can also contribute to soil drying and desertification in some regions, making it difficult to sustain agriculture.

    Livestock Health and Productivity:

    Heat stress can negatively impact livestock health, reduce productivity, and lead to decreased fertility and reproduction rates. Changes in vegetation patterns and water availability can also affect grazing areas and feed availability for livestock.

    Food Security and Price Volatility:

    The cumulative effects of these challenges can lead to reduced agricultural productivity, which in turn can affect food availability and drive up food prices. Vulnerable populations, especially in developing countries, may be disproportionately affected by food insecurity.

    Adaptation and Resilience:

    Farmers and agricultural systems need to adapt to these changing conditions by adopting new practices, crop varieties, and technologies that are better suited to the evolving climate. Building resilient agricultural systems that can withstand shocks and stresses is essential.

    Addressing these challenges requires a multi-faceted approach involving government policies, research and innovation, international cooperation, and community engagement. It's crucial to mitigate the impacts of climate change on agriculture to ensure global food security and sustainable livelihoods for farmers.
